Lines Matching refs:txd
1211 return efx_nic_alloc_buffer(tx_queue->efx, &tx_queue->txd.buf, in efx_ef10_tx_probe()
1219 const efx_qword_t *txd) in efx_ef10_push_tx_desc() argument
1226 reg.qword[0] = *txd; in efx_ef10_push_tx_desc()
1237 size_t entries = tx_queue->txd.buf.len / EFX_BUF_SIZE; in efx_ef10_tx_init()
1242 efx_qword_t *txd; in efx_ef10_tx_init() local
1256 dma_addr = tx_queue->txd.buf.dma_addr; in efx_ef10_tx_init()
1281 txd = efx_tx_desc(tx_queue, 0); in efx_ef10_tx_init()
1282 EFX_POPULATE_QWORD_4(*txd, in efx_ef10_tx_init()
1290 efx_ef10_push_tx_desc(tx_queue, txd); in efx_ef10_tx_init()
1325 efx_nic_free_buffer(tx_queue->efx, &tx_queue->txd.buf); in efx_ef10_tx_remove()
1345 efx_qword_t *txd; in efx_ef10_tx_write() local
1354 txd = efx_tx_desc(tx_queue, write_ptr); in efx_ef10_tx_write()
1359 *txd = buffer->option; in efx_ef10_tx_write()
1363 *txd, in efx_ef10_tx_write()
1374 txd = efx_tx_desc(tx_queue, in efx_ef10_tx_write()
1376 efx_ef10_push_tx_desc(tx_queue, txd); in efx_ef10_tx_write()